Job Description - Senior Programme Manager

We're looking for an Senior Programme Manager



Based in London. The Senior Programme Manager will lead complex, multi‑workstream programmes across the London Insurance Market, delivering strategic change spanning across Hamilton Global Speciality. They will ensure programmes are delivered on time, within budget, and in line with market standards.




What you will do





    • Lead end‑to‑end programme delivery across multiple business domains (e.g., underwriting, claims, finance, operations, technology).

    • Develop programme structure, governance frameworks, RAID management, reporting dashboards, and resource plans.

    • Ensure alignment with corporate strategy, operating model, and London Market initiatives (Blueprint Two, ACORD standards, LIMOSS services, etc.).

    • Support interface between executive leadership, market participants, IT teams, and operational functions.

    • Support steering committees, executive updates, and cross‑market collaboration.

    • Manage expectations across underwriting teams, claims leaders, operations, reserving/actuarial, finance, and Lloyd’s/MGA partners.

    • Maintain RAID logs, mitigation plans, and quality assurance.

    • Manage dependencies across projects, ensuring alignment with business change cycles (renewal season, bordereaux cycles, audit windows, etc.).

    • Support programme budgeting, forecasting, commercial management, and reporting.

    • Track financial performance against KPIs and ensure value delivery.

    • Support business change activities, including TOM design, process mapping, training, UAT, and transition planning.

    • Enable adoption of technology solutions (e.g., policy admin systems, claims platforms, bordereaux tools, data transformation, reporting solutions).

    • Ensure cultural alignment and capability uplift within business teams.



    What you require for the role





      • Deep understanding of insurance operations: underwriting, claims, delegated authority, finance, compliance.

      • Strong knowledge of London Market technologies and processes (e.g., PPL, DCOM/Blueprint Two, Workbench, DXC services, ACORD messaging).

      • Demonstrated experience leading multi‑million‑pound programmes with complex stakeholder landscapes.

      • Proven track record in organisational and technology transformation.

      • Expertise in governance, RAID management, planning, and structured delivery methodologies (e.g., PRINCE2, MSP, Agile).

      • Excellent communication and influencing skills at executive level.

          In good company




          Hamilton (NYSE: HG) underwrites specialty insurance and reinsurance risks on a global basis through its wholly owned subsidiaries. Its three underwriting platforms: Hamilton Global Specialty, Hamilton Select and Hamilton Re, each with dedicated and experienced leadership, provide access to diversified and profitable business around the world.




          Headquartered in Bermuda, Hamilton has over 600 employees with key underwriting operations in London, Bermuda, the US and Dublin.
